Goodreads asked D.L. Havlin:

How do you deal with writer’s block?

D.L. Havlin Dealing with writers block isn't a problem I've had to face in 20+ years of writing. I believe the reason I haven't faced this obstacle is life lesssons learned and the manner in which I pursue my craft. First - Because I started writing at an advanced age and have been fortunate to have an extensive life resume my primary problem is having time to write about all the things I'd like not the reverse. Second - I believe readers are thinkers. With this in mind, the research I do to satisfy my readers creates many paths do execute my basic themes. Third - I'm an outliner and planner. I know precisely what I want to accomplish and how I'll do it before I start writing. That doesn't preclude me from drastically changing my plans when a creative possibility comes along.
